Formula
fluid ounce per years = megaliters per fortnight × 882165584.763
This factor comes from each unit's defined relationship to the category's base unit: 1 megaliter per fortnight equals 0.00082671957672 base units, and 1 fluid ounce per years equals 9.371478e-13 base units, so dividing one by the other gives the direct megaliter per fortnight-to-fluid ounce per years factor of 882165584.763.

What's the difference between volumetric and mass flow rate?
Volumetric flow rate measures the volume of fluid passing a point per unit time (for example, liters per second). Mass flow rate measures the mass instead. For a fluid of constant density the two are directly proportional, but for compressible fluids like gases, mass flow is often the more meaningful quantity.
